Summary Nr: 138707.015 | Event: 08/23/2021 | Employee Is Killed By Asphyxiation When Caught In Machine | ||||
At 8:18 a.m. on August 23, 2021, an employee was adjusting a proximity switch in side a tire uniformity machine. This switch can also be adjusted from the outsid e of the machine. The employee removed the guard to adjust the switch from the i nside when the lube drive rollers moved up. The employee was killed by mechanica l asphyxiation after his upper body (head, neck and chest) were caught in the ma chine. | ||||||
